What is OWC Pharmaceutical Research Debt-to-EBITDA?

OWC Pharmaceutical Research OWCP -90.00% Debt-to-EBITDA is -0.02 as of Sep. 2019.

Debt-to-EBITDA measures a company's ability to pay off its debt.

OWC Pharmaceutical Research's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2019 was $0.03 Mil. OWC Pharmaceutical Research's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2019 was $0.02 Mil. OWC Pharmaceutical Research's annualized E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2019 was $-2.34 Mil. OWC Pharmaceutical Research's annualized Debt-to-E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2019 was -0.02.

A high Debt-to-EBITDA ratio generally means that a company may spend more time to paying off its debt. According to Joel Tillinghast's BIG MONEY THINKS SMALL: Biases, Blind Spots, and Smarter Investing, a ratio of Debt-to-EBITDA exceeding four is usually considered scary unless tangible assets cover the debt.

OWC Pharmaceutical Research  (OTCPK:OWCP) Debt-to-EBITDA Explanation

In the calculation of Debt-to-EBITDA, we use the total of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ation divided by EBITDA. In some calculations, Total Liabilities is used to for calculation.

OWC Pharmaceutical Research Debt-to-EBITDA Calculation

Debt-to-EBITDA measures a company's ability to pay off its debt.

OWC Pharmaceutical Research's Debt-to-EBITDA for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2018 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(0 + 0) / -10.248
=0.00

OWC Pharmaceutical Research's annualized Debt-to-E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2019 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(0.026 + 0.021) / -2.34
=-0.02

In the calculation of annual Debt-to-EBITDA, the EBITDA of the last fiscal year is used. In calculating the annualized quarterly data, the EBITDA data used here is four times the quarterly (Sep. 2019) EBITDA data.

OWC Pharmaceutical Research Business Description

Address 2 Ben Gurion Street, Ramat Gan, ISR, 4514760
OWC Pharmaceutical Research Corp is a medical cannabis research and development company. The firm through its subsidiary researches and develops cannabis-based products and treatments specifically designed for multiple myeloma, psoriasis, fibromyalgia, post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), migraine, sexual function and skin disorders. It also provides consulting services to governmental and private entities to assist them with developing and implementing tailor-made medical cannabis program.
